Today, [for other than Volvos] the 18 is the go-to standard option for speculation sale trucks to be sold off the showroom lot. The 13 has largely been swapped out for the 18 over the past 10 years for spec and owner-operator trucks. They're ideal especially for the western state 105k haulers.
Why some 48 state fleets still order with 10 speeds is a mystery to me. Weight maybe? -
